Chincholi Bhose
Chincholi Bhose is a village in Pandharpur, Sholāpur District, Maharashtra. Chincholi Bhose is situated nearby to the village Bhatumbare, as well as near Takli.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Pandharpur City is a popular pilgrimage town, on the banks of Chandrabhagā River, near Solapur city in Solapur District, Maharashtra, India. Its administrative area is one of eleven tehsils in the District, and it is an electoral constituency of the state legislative assembly. Pandharpur is situated 3½ km southeast of Chincholi Bhose.
